A bit about us:

We are seeking an experienced Senior Network Integration Engineer to support the modernization of mission-critical telecommunications infrastructure. This role focuses on integrating fiber and IP-based circuits while leading the transition from legacy copper and TDM transport systems to modern IP-enabled architectures across geographically distributed environments.

The ideal candidate combines deep technical expertise with hands-on implementation experience and thrives in highly available, mission-critical environments.

Job Details

Responsibilities
  • Analyze network architectures, engineering drawings, and system requirements to identify design improvements and integration requirements.
  • Lead modernization initiatives involving migration from legacy copper and TDM transport systems to fiber-based IP networks.
  • Support technical integration of enterprise networking infrastructure including optical transport, fiber, IP networking, and hybrid legacy environments.
  • Configure, optimize, troubleshoot, and validate enterprise network protocols including BGP, TCP/IP, MPLS, and IPv6.
  • Perform circuit turn-up, network cutovers, migration activities, and end-to-end testing to ensure operational readiness.
  • Troubleshoot complex network and telecommunications issues across fiber, optical transport, and legacy infrastructure.
  • Provide technical leadership during deployment activities while coordinating with engineering teams and stakeholders.
  • Present technical updates, architecture recommendations, risk assessments, and integration plans to leadership.
  • Identify technical risks and develop mitigation strategies to ensure system reliability, redundancy, and operational continuity.
  • Support long-term infrastructure planning, network growth, and modernization initiatives.

Required Qualifications
  • U.S. Citizenship.
  • Ability to obtain and maintain a Public Trust clearance.
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Systems, or related technical discipline (or equivalent combination of education and experience).
  • 8+ years of experience in network engineering, systems administration, telecommunications, or infrastructure engineering.
  • 5+ years of experience configuring and troubleshooting enterprise networking technologies including BGP, TCP/IP, MPLS, and IPv6.
  • Experience with optical networking, fiber infrastructure, SONET transport, metro ring architectures, and wired/wireless networks.
  • Experience supporting mission-critical network infrastructure.
  • Strong understanding of systems integration and infrastructure modernization.

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ience leading large-scale technical integration projects.
  • Cloud networking experience with AWS, Azure, or Google Cloud Platform.
  • Experience with network capacity planning and infrastructure forecasting.
  • Cisco CCNA or Network+ certification.
  • Cisco CCNP Enterprise certification.
  • AWS Solutions Architect – Associate certification.
  • PMP certification.
  • Experience supporting federal or other highly regulated mission-critical environments.
